An open-source, interactive data visualization library for Python
Project description
plotly.py
Latest Release | |
User forum | |
PyPI Downloads | |
License |
Quickstart
pip install plotly==6.0.0rc0
import plotly.express as px
fig = px.bar(x=["a", "b", "c"], y=[1, 3, 2])
fig.show()
See the Python documentation for more examples.
Overview
plotly.py is an interactive, open-source, and browser-based graphing library for Python :sparkles:
Built on top of plotly.js, plotly.py
is a high-level, declarative charting library. plotly.js ships with over 30 chart types, including scientific charts, 3D graphs, statistical charts, SVG maps, financial charts, and more.
plotly.py
is MIT Licensed. Plotly graphs can be viewed in Jupyter notebooks, standalone HTML files, or integrated into Dash applications.
Contact us for consulting, dashboard development, application integration, and feature additions.
Installation
plotly.py may be installed using pip
pip install plotly==6.0.0rc0
or conda.
conda install -c plotly plotly=6.0.0rc0
Jupyter Widget Support
For use as a Jupyter widget, install jupyter
and anywidget
packages using pip
:
pip install jupyter anywidget
or conda
:
conda install jupyter anywidget
Static Image Export
plotly.py supports static image export,
using either the kaleido
package (recommended, supported as of plotly
version 4.9) or the orca
command line utility (legacy as of plotly
version 4.9).
Kaleido
The kaleido
package has no dependencies and can be installed
using pip
pip install -U kaleido
or conda
conda install -c conda-forge python-kaleido
Extended Geo Support
Some plotly.py features rely on fairly large geographic shape files. The county
choropleth figure factory is one such example. These shape files are distributed as a
separate plotly-geo
package. This package can be installed using pip...
pip install plotly-geo==1.0.0
or conda
conda install -c plotly plotly-geo=1.0.0
Copyright and Licenses
Code and documentation copyright 2019 Plotly, Inc.
Code released under the MIT license.
Docs released under the Creative Commons license.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file plotly-6.0.0rc0.tar.gz
.
File metadata
- Download URL: plotly-6.0.0rc0.tar.gz
- Upload date:
- Size: 8.1 MB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/5.1.1 CPython/3.10.15
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 7328567c86a5780a4e9dfdf632c24a7b8d7b375d0446aa1615b40adcf00acfa4 |
|
MD5 | 2d280ea49381c2221b256d4ba1589d9a |
|
BLAKE2b-256 | fca48fe56a6662e478a55649d458553121542475b380f8ef2376c59ae974a315 |
File details
Details for the file plotly-6.0.0rc0-py3-none-any.whl
.
File metadata
- Download URL: plotly-6.0.0rc0-py3-none-any.whl
- Upload date:
- Size: 14.8 MB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/5.1.1 CPython/3.10.15
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| a2d5cf60f0930e9817826da0491749c78d0ca587f21414b701fb029be6683530 |
|
MD5 | 0fb098442015abc14c5b1ba6ec1743ac |
|
BLAKE2b-256 | 451b3c058b6e883a7ddc122b3d0e6552bff1b5b4ab712444bb4e320517d9b944 |